BirdLife South Africa operates in the environmental services field with a focus on bird conservation in South Africa. It participates in the BirdLife International network, enabling collaboration with international partners on conservation initiatives. A concrete example of its work is the Mouse-Free Marion Project, a partnership with the South African Department of Forestry, Fisheries & the Environment to protect Marion Island's ecosystem from invasive mice. 

The organization has engaged in public awareness initiatives, including naming Bird of the Year for 2024, the Bateleur. Operating with a very small staff, it works within the global conservation network and collaborates with government and other partners through that network.
